Address

bc1qvdu269nfsxmx07yq8vhdl3ru6ay38glw97dpj6
Confirmed tx count
31
Confirmed received
26 outputs (0.72236808 BTC)
Confirmed spent
26 outputs (0.72236808 BTC)
Confirmed unspent
No outputs

25 of 31 Transactions